Perhaps so, but consider the following phrases:
"Choose either one or other" <== XOR (the "either" makes it exclusive)
"Choose one of the following..." <== XOR
"Choose one or other" <== ambiguous; doesn't seem that it should imply it's XOR (at least IMHO).
"Choose any of those" <== implies OR
It seems to me that we already make XOR explicit as is the case with first two phrases but assume XOR in the penultimate phrase.
